The need of development services in the field of .NET is ever increasing with increase in the number of businesses in the demand seeking secured, scalable and high-performance applications. Enterprise solution or web platform, cloud-based app, whatever it is, acquiring the right talent is the key. However, perhaps you are only now beginning the process and you may be wondering: How do I hire .NET developers, what are the kinds of skills/rabies to go after, how much can I afford and what are the best practices?
This guide provides the answers to such questions in easy words. By the end of it, you will be informed about what you need to factor in when outsourcing committed .NET developers, how much money to spend on it and how to ensure this process is made effective and fruitful.
Reasons as to why the Business uses .NET Developers
To start the hiring process it is very essential to know why there are so many organizations that use the .NET framework and why they prefer hiring the.NET developers as opposed to using other technologies.
- Loyal track record: .NET which was supported by Microsoft is years old and is one of the most enjoyable platforms of developing complex applications.
- Flexibility: .NET can be used by developers to build web, desktop, mobile, and even IoT apps.
- Scalability: The framework can expand with your business demand regardless of whether it is a startup or a business.
- Cloud integration: Azure enables a company focusing on development in the context of .NET to create and expand on the use of clouds.
- Security: Microsoft keeps on reinforcing .NET with good security aspects and this makes it perfect in the field of finance, medical and e-business.
In simple terms, at the time when businesses seek a long term and reliable solution, they will tend to attract contracted .NET designers who will provide efficiency and quality.
Skills to Find in a.NET Developer
Are you asking yourself what a developer needs to possess, we may truck it up. In a bid to deal with the right talent, put attention on the following:
- Core Technical Skills
An example of what a good.NET developer is aware of:
- C# programming language
- ASP.NET Asp.net core, and MVC frameworks.
- Working with SQL server and other databases.
- Developing and using British North American APIs.
- These cloud platforms may include Microsoft Azure.
- Front-End Knowledge
Although not compulsory, a full-stack .NET programmer, knowledgeable in HTML, CSS, JavaScript, or Blazor is sought by many clients. This assists in the case of a requirement of end to end development.
- Problem-Solving & Soft Skills
It is not sufficient to use technical expertise. Intense communication, group effort, and flexibility are also beneficial to the table of the best developers.
- Certifications & Experience
There are those companies that would like to have Microsoft-certified. NET developer as it demonstrates technical skills. However, the benefit of practical project experience is equally good.
Hiring .NET Developers as Models
You would want to use three possibilities when determining the way to relate with developers:
- Freelancers – Appropriate to small and small ones. They are cheap but can not be accountable.
- In-House Developers– It can be very costly to issue full time workers because of the payment of salaries, benefits and infrastructures.
- Outsource specialized NET developers in a firm – This becomes the most balanced one.Â
Flexibility, experience, and secure project delivery of a .NET development company are some benefits of the cooperation.
This third option is favored by many firms in the current world as they can easily scale the teams and save them the hustle of hiring.
Cost of Hiring .NET Developers
One of the most general issues is cost. The thing is that, geographical, skills, and type of application make rangewide changes in the hourly rate of the .NET developer.
- Exceptional developers can charge creation costs between $50 to $120 an hour in the UK or US.
- In Eastern-Europe, the costs range from 30 to 60 per hour.
- You can always get super-specialized net developers in India or Asia at $20-40/hours.
- Junior .NET developer full-time positions may begin with a salary of $50,000/per annum and seniors can earn starting at above $100,000 per annum in Western countries.
The most value is usually offered by outsourcing to an offshore .NET development company since one receives quality developers at affordable prices without reducing their quality.
Hiring the Best.NET Developers
You have got ideas on what craft to take into consideration and on how much you need to budget, now it is time move on to some put-tested best practices which will make the process smoother:
Get Your Project Scope Strauss
Whatever you require before contacting first-time job seekers, two terms will be of great use: web development, enterprise software, or cloud-based applications.
Create an Excellent Job Description
Job description contributes to recruiting the talent. Indicate whether you need a .NET core developer to be hired, a full-stack developed based on .NET developer or a dedicated team to do .NET development.
Use Technical Assessments
Add coding tests, real world assignments or technical interviews to test abilities.
Check Portfolios and Check References
They should consistently enquire about the previous projects or customer feedback. This will be a measure to prevent hiring errors.
Start with a Small Project
Checking whether to or not, start with a pilot project. This will reveal to the developer whether they have the ability to meet deadlines and high expectations of you.
Test Communication
Associated with a remote connection with developers of remote .NET, clear communication will enable success.
Where to Find and Hire .NET Developers
To have a practical location, they would be as follows:
- Initially, one can use job boards such as LinkedIn, Indeed, and Glassdoor to hire in-house.
- Individual developers can be connected via free freelance websites such as Upwork mighty or Toptal.
- A partnership with a .NET development firm would provide you with a source of vetted professional developers who would be readily available to handle your project.
- Passive ones such as networking and technological events are also effective but less known.
When a business is interested in long term commitment and quality, consummate partnering with a reputed.NET development services provider can be the way to go.
Why Work With a .NET Development Company
Although it is possible to employ freelance workers or create an internal team, it is quite simple to note benefits of outsourcing to a specialized company specializing in development of .NET:
- Availability of a vast committed team in P. NET development team with varying capabilities.
- Scalability – This means that it can expand or contract according to the requirements of the project.
- Savage costs in terms of keeping in-house employees.
- Accountability and project management Mapped in.
- Emerging reputation and referent case studies.
Recruitment of a company is also time-saving, as you do not need to make each candidate go through numerous screening and tests to be hired.
Conclusion
One of the key decisions you will make in relation to your project is hiring the right talent. With an appropriate speciality in the right skills, knowledge of the hourly rate of a .NET developer, and best practices you will not make expensive pitfalls and construct better applications.
Any startup or a small growing company will find it best to outsource genuine .NET programmers with a reputable .NET development firm and who in turn are the most clever. In this manner, you can access the expertise, scalability and reliability required to enable you to put your ideas into practice.When you are willing to take the step then you should consider engaging the services of a professional team which provides end to end .NET development services. The correct decision now can save you time, money, and every headache that you will get tomorrow.

